Secret Invasion (Disney+) - 5/10

 

I love me a good spy-based thriller, especially one with Cold War-vibes.  But that's not this show.  It's a horrible mish-mash of vague ideas and poorly thought out storylines.

 

The basic premise of the show - a race of alien shapeshifters have infiltrated governments around the world to take over the planet - sounds like it is ripe for some intriguing stories.  So how did it end up being so dull? Maybe it's exhaustion from all the Marvel content over the past decade, or the generally high-quality we've come to expect.  Or maybe it was just smashed together in the hope that audiences wouldn't notice?  The saving grace is that it's only 6 episodes, so it's bingeable without being bingeable.  I watched it within a week, but after the first couple of episodes I just wanted to get through it (damn my need for completion!).

 

Samuel L Jackson is one of those guys I would watch reading the telephone book (if you can still find one).  But he's all over the place here.  The cast should be the strongest point here, but aside from a few scene-stealers (Ben Mendelsohn and Olivia Colman - who is always incredible), everyone falls flat.  The storyline is both super obvious and pointless.  I kept waiting for some sharp writing to grip me, but it never arrived.  There's a plot line around episode 2 or 3 (no spoilers) which is so obvious I spotted it a mile away, yet the characters (who are supposed to be super spies) seem oblivious to it because...plot!  The master plan of the villains is banal (think Pinky and the Brain - they want to take over the world!), and the method is just hand-wavey "science stuff".

 

It's so boring I can't even bring myself to finish the review.  Bleh...
